- Resource &1 is not a container ?The SAP error message
/SAPAPO/PPM_STORAGE009 Resource &1 is not a container
typically occurs in the context of Advanced Planning and Optimization (APO) when working with production planning and scheduling. This error indicates that the system is expecting a resource to be a container, but the specified resource is not defined as such in the system.Cause:
- Resource Definition: The resource specified in the error message is not defined as a container resource in the system. In SAP APO, container resources are used to manage the storage and transportation of materials.
- Incorrect Resource Type: The resource type may not be set correctly in the configuration, leading the system to misinterpret the resource's capabilities.
- Master Data Issues: There may be issues with the master data configuration for the resource, such as missing or incorrect settings.
Solution:
Check Resource Configuration:
- Go to the resource master data in SAP APO and verify that the resource is defined as a container. You can do this by navigating to the relevant transaction (e.g.,
/SAPAPO/RES01
for resource maintenance).- Ensure that the resource type is set correctly to indicate that it is a container.
Adjust Resource Settings:
- If the resource is not intended to be a container, you may need to adjust the planning scenario or the way the resource is being used in the planning process.
- If it should be a container, update the resource settings to reflect this.
Review Master Data:
- Check the master data for any inconsistencies or missing information related to the resource. Ensure that all necessary fields are filled out correctly.
Consult Documentation:
- Refer to SAP documentation or help resources for more detailed information on configuring resources and containers in APO.
Testing:
- After making changes, test the planning scenario again to see if the error persists.
